Output 5431c6d38c265af56ea347a13f15bdac020ac93fef0a2e1791737377de6d8461:2

value
113086040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8bd67b834fc2f84e21c97a966441fc40c89061 OP_EQUAL
address
MLob2ad3HDGHiV2zAoeCqsyMZnKQAa2DzP
transaction
5431c6d38c265af56ea347a13f15bdac020ac93fef0a2e1791737377de6d8461
spent
true